Animal Science is a vital branch of agriculture focusing on the care, management, and production of domestic animals like cattle, sheep, goats, pigs, poultry, and horses. This field also explores key areas such as animal nutrition, genetics, physiology, health, and welfare.

JAMB Subject Combination for Animal Science

To gain admission for Animal Science, you must sit for the following subjects in JAMB:

  • English Language (mandatory)
  • Chemistry
  • Biology or Agricultural Science
  • Mathematics or Physics

These subjects ensure students have a strong foundation in science and are well-prepared for the course.

O’Level Requirements for Animal Science

Prospective students must have a minimum of five credits in WAEC, NECO, or GCE. These credits should include:

  • English Language
  • Mathematics
  • Chemistry
  • Biology or Agricultural Science
  • One other science subject

Ensure these requirements are met to avoid disqualification during the admission process.

Direct Entry Requirements

If you possess advanced qualifications such as a National Diploma (ND), Higher National Diploma (HND), or NCE in Animal Science or related disciplines, you may qualify for Direct Entry:

  • You should have at least an Upper Credit or Distinction in your ND or HND, or a Credit in NCE
  • Meeting the O’Level requirements is also mandatory
  • Some universities may conduct screening tests or interviews as part of the admission process
  • Direct Entry students can often enter the course at the 200 or 300 level

Cut-off Marks and JAMB Scores

To study Animal Science, you need a JAMB score of at least 180. However, some universities may have higher cut-off marks, so it’s essential to check the specific requirements of your preferred institution.

List of Universities Offering Animal Science in Nigeria

Animal Science is offered in numerous universities across Nigeria, including federal, state, and private institutions.

Federal Universities

  • University of Abuja
  • Ahmadu Bello University, Zaria
  • University of Nigeria, Nsukka
  • Obafemi Awolowo University, Ile-Ife
  • Federal University of Agriculture, Abeokuta
  • Federal University of Technology, Owerri

State Universities

  • Delta State University
  • Ebonyi State University
  • Nasarawa State University
  • Ladoke Akintola University of Technology
  • Rivers State University

Private Universities

  • Landmark University
  • Joseph Ayo Babalola University
  • Hezekiah University

These universities provide various specialisations, including Animal Breeding, Animal Physiology, and Environmental Biology.

Career Opportunities in Animal Science

Graduates of Animal Science can explore diverse career paths, such as:

  • Livestock Production Specialist
  • Animal Nutritionist
  • Veterinary Assistant
  • Wildlife Conservationist
  • Agricultural Extension Officer

The skills gained from this course are in demand across sectors like agriculture, research, education, and biotechnology.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) on Studying Animal Science in Nigeria

What is the duration of the course?

Most universities offer Animal Science as a four or five-year programme, depending on the institution and mode of entry.

Is Animal Science competitive?

While not as competitive as Medicine or Law, some universities may have high demand for this course, requiring strong academic performance.

What is the average salary for graduates?

Entry-level salaries range from ₦50,000 to ₦120,000 monthly, with potential for growth in specialised or managerial roles.

What is the benefit of studying Animal Science?

This course equips students with practical and theoretical knowledge to address food security, animal welfare, and agricultural development.
